Uptimize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Uptimize in the United States is $87,031.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Uptimize typically range from $76,103 to $99,575 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Uptimize
Uptimize is a learning platform connecting the entire neurodiversity ecosystem. Their mission is to pioneer and facilitate neurodiversity in the workplace through online training. Uptimize creates slick, bite-sized video learning tools both for neurodivergent individuals wishing to get hired and advance their career, and for organizations looking to better include neurodiverse talent.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Denver?

Understanding the cost of living near Denver is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Uptimize.
Denver's Cost of Living Index is approximately 112.1 (12.1% more expensive than US average; 6.5% more than CO average). Housing costs are the primary driver above US average, high demand, vibrant city. Light Rail/Bus (RTD). When planning your budget based on a salary from Uptimize,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,600 - $2,400+ A significant portion of Uptimize sal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$114 (RTD monthly regional p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,044 - $4,694+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
